examined   
adinina ~ to be enquired about, to be investigated; to be examined, as in a public examination of a school, etc. ~ to be examined, to be questioned
fakafakaina ~ to be examined closely
fakaina ~ to be searched to the root, to be examined minutely. Redup. also used.
an-dinidinika ~ looked at minutely, examined carefully, talked over in detail. All the forms of dinika are frequently reduplicated
anterina ~ to be examined, scrutinised, done repeatedly so as to impress something on the memory
tarataraina ~ to be examined minutely, to be investigated
voafaka ~ scrutinised, examined closely.

examined (to be)   
dinihina ~ to be examined into, to be talked over minutely, to be admonished ~ to be closely examined
fantarina ~ to be examined, to be proved, to be tried, to be understood ~ to be known, to be tested
fotorana ~ to be held by the roots, or close to the head, as one holding a hammer ~ to be investigated

examined into   
voadinika ~ examined into, talked over, admonished, told minutely
